Mangalyadhaaranam

The Thaali, a sacred thread, signifies the new bond that is now formed between the bride, the groom and their respective families. The ritual to tie this Thaali, Maangalyadhaaranam, is initiated by Kanyadhaanam - where the bride is seated on her father's lap. The father then proceeds to hand his daughter over to the groom and offers the couple his blessings. 

The Maangalyadhaaranam is timed to the exact auspicious minute, where the bride remains seated on her father’s lap, the bridegroom ties the Thaali around her neck. Three knots are tied, the first one by the bridegroom and the other two by the bridegroom’s sister to make the bride a part of their family.
